dc.description.abstract Gelatinized native corn starch dispersion (GSD, 5g/100 mL water) was diluted with ethanol/water mixtures (EWM, 0.0, 5.0, 10.0 and 20.0 ml ethanol/ml water) to a final concentration of 2.0 g GSD/100 mL EWM. The different EWM are representative of the ethanol content of different typical alcoholic drinks. The GSD were subjected to digestion by porcine pancreas α-amylase at 37 oC for 90 min. The percentage of digested starch reduced as an inverse function of EWM concentration. For 20.0 ml ethanol/ml water mixture the digested starch percentage was reduced by about 50%. Log-of-slope (LOS) method was used for analyzing the digestion kinetics curve, showing the presence of two (fast and slow) time scales. The fast and slow digestion kinetics were linked to rapidly (RDS) and slowly (SDS) starch fractions. It was found that ethanol reduced the RDS fraction, while increasing the resistant starch (RS) fraction. FTIR analysis suggested that modification of the enzyme secondary structure is behind the inhibition of the α-amylase activity by ethanol solvation. es
